1. Tap Into Online Job Portals
A major starting point for job seekers is the use of online job platforms:
-
Ofertapune.net: One of the most popular and reliable job portals in Kosovo, featuring a broad range of job listings across various sectors.
-
LinkedIn: More than just a networking tool, LinkedIn is an essential platform for job seekers to explore opportunities, connect with employers, and showcase their professional background.
-
Indeed: This global platform includes listings for jobs based in Kosovo, including opportunities for remote work, which are becoming increasingly common.

6. Know the Legal Requirements
If you’re not a Kosovan citizen, there are some legal steps to consider:
-
Temporary Residence Permit: Non-citizens generally require a temporary residence permit to live and work in Kosovo.
-
Work Permit: Once you receive a job offer, your employer must apply for a work permit on your behalf.
